Ear Wellness 101: What You Need to Know

When it comes to overall health, ear wellness often takes a back seat to other more visible concerns. However, maintaining good ear health is crucial for effective communication and balance. For many, hearing is one of the most valuable senses, and the health of our ears plays a critical role in our quality of life. This article aims to guide you through some essential aspects of ear wellness, offering practical tips and insights to keep your ears healthy and functioning optimally.

First and foremost, understanding the structure and function of the ear is vital. The ear is divided into three main parts: the outer ear, middle ear, and inner ear. The outer ear includes the visible part, known as the pinna, and the ear canal. The middle ear contains three tiny bones called ossicles that help transmit sound vibrations to the inner ear, which houses the cochlea and auditory nerve. The inner ear is crucial for both hearing and balance.

One common issue that can arise in ear health is the accumulation of earwax, or cerumen. While earwax serves a protective purpose—keeping dirt and debris out of the ear canal—too much of it can lead to blockages, discomfort, and even hearing loss. Instead of using cotton swabs, which can push wax further down, consider using a few drops of mineral oil or saline solution to soften wax. If you’re experiencing symptoms of blockage, consult a healthcare professional for safe removal options.

Another important aspect of ear wellness is protecting your ears from excessive noise. Prolonged exposure to loud sounds can lead to hearing damage or loss, a condition that affects millions of people worldwide. Whether you’re attending a concert, using power tools, or listening to music through headphones, it’s wise to limit volume levels and take breaks to give your ears a rest. Investing in earplugs or noise-canceling headphones can also provide effective protection.

Maintaining a healthy lifestyle can have a substantial impact on ear wellness. Diet plays a key role in overall health, and certain nutrients can support auditory functions. For instance, antioxidants like vitamins C and E, magnesium, and omega-3 fatty acids may help protect against age-related hearing loss. Incorporating fruits, vegetables, nuts, and fatty fish into your diet can be beneficial for your ears as well as your overall health.

Regular check-ups with an audiologist or an ear, nose, and throat (ENT) specialist are integral for maintaining ear health. Early detection and management of potential issues can prevent further complications. If you notice sudden changes in your hearing, such as ringing in the ears (tinnitus), muffled sounds, or persistent ear pain, you should seek medical advice promptly.

Additionally, it is vital to manage any existing health conditions that could impact your ear function. Conditions like diabetes, hypertension, and respiratory infections can affect ear health, so staying proactive about managing these issues is important. Proper hydration, regular exercise, and avoiding smoking are all lifestyle changes that contribute positively to your ear wellness.
